Preview

Church of St. Peter and the ruins of Werner Chapel, Bacharach, UNESCO World Heritage Site Upper Middle Rhine Valley, Rhineland-Palatinate, Germany, Europe
Church of St. Peter and the ruins of Werner Chapel, Bacharach, UNESCO World Heritage Site Upper Middle Rhine Valley, Rhineland-Palatinate, Germany, Europe
Image ID: 832-136386
Artist: Walter G. Allgower
Purchase a commercial license Buy framed prints & more from our print store